Transaction 826898c71fc4b048335a00722b243716c80e8a9c0194e625bc29e496739ce35d
1 Input
1 Output
-
826898c71fc4b048335a00722b243716c80e8a9c0194e625bc29e496739ce35d:0
- value
- 27672
- script pubkey
- OP_0 OP_PUSHBYTES_20 5ea68ee477a7a81bd6546b92689c0d5cb8411fce
- address
- bc1qt6ngaerh575ph4j5dwfx38qdtjuyz87wl6x09q